ASUS is turning out so many products in so many market sectors that it would be odd if we didn't find a CPU cooler among them. However, earlier coolers from ASUS were not very efficient and the company now tries to correct this by introducing two new models on heat pipes. They are called Silent Square Pro and Silent Square.
The senior, Pro, model differs from the junior one in having a differently shaped casing and a higher fan speed. It also comes with a speed controller that also supports speed monitoring.
But in this review I?ll be talking about the simpler and cheaper ASUS Silent Square.
The second word in the cooler name turned to be an abbreviation that spells out like this:
- Superior performance
- Quiet (with a noise level of 18dBA)
- Universal application (supports K8, LGA775 and Socket 478 platforms)
- Aesthetics (highlighted fan)
- Reliable (cools the CPU power circuit)
- Easy assembly
